The Motivation Behind Decentralizing Twitter
The primary driver for moving Twitter onto a blockchain stems from widespread frustration with centralized control. Traditional social media platforms act as absolute authorities over content moderation, algorithm changes, and account suspensions, often making decisions that appear arbitrary or politically biased. Blockchain provides a technical foundation for alternative protocols where community governance replaces unilateral corporate control, potentially creating a more resilient and user-centric network.
Core Technical Components
Implementing Twitter on blockchain relies on several interconnected technologies. Decentralized storage solutions like IPFS or Filecoin handle media and content storage, while smart contracts on platforms like Ethereum or newer L2s manage the business logic of interactions. Cryptographic key pairs replace traditional login credentials, giving users direct ownership of their identity and data without relying on a central authority to reset passwords or control access.
Tokenomics and Incentive Structures
A functional blockchain-based Twitter ecosystem requires thoughtful economic design. Governance tokens can enable voting on protocol changes, content moderation policies, and treasury allocation, aligning platform evolution with community interests. Additionally, token incentives might reward quality content creation, constructive engagement, and spam detection, creating a more meritocratic attention economy than current advertisement-driven models.
Challenges and Real-World Considerations
Despite the theoretical advantages, significant hurdles remain for mainstream blockchain Twitter adoption. Scalability limitations of current blockchain networks could impact user experience, with transaction fees and confirmation times creating friction compared to Web2 alternatives. User experience complexity, including wallet management and gas fees, presents another barrier that must be solved through thoughtful interface design and potential abstraction layers.
Moderation and Legal Compliance
Content moderation on a decentralized network poses unique challenges. While blockchain ensures immutability, completely unmoderated platforms can become hostile environments. Many proposals involve combining on-chain reputation systems with community-driven moderation, potentially using specialized subDAOs to handle contentious cases. Balancing free expression with safety and complying with regional regulations remains an open problem requiring innovative technical and social solutions.
